Breathing attachments for anaesthetic purposes for human use

Specifies basic requirements for breathing attachments, including sequence and dimensions of conical fittings of 15 mm and 22 mm sizes, used for adult and paediatric purposes. Dimensions and form of screw-threaded, weight-bearing connections for use with attachments for anaesthetic apparatus and ventilators are also specified.
